Why Having a Website is a Game Changer for Painting Contractors

Many contractors rely on word-of-mouth and referrals, which are great, but a website takes things a step further. Here’s how a good website can help:

  • Helps More Customers Find You – When someone searches for “painters in Santa Rosa” or “Sonoma County painting contractors,” a search-optimized site ensures you’re in the running.
  • Showcases Your Work – A collection of project photos makes it easy for potential clients to see what you can do.
  • Makes It Easy to Get in Touch – A simple contact form or call-to-action makes scheduling a quote effortless.
  • Builds Trust and Credibility – A professional website reassures potential clients that they’re working with a reputable business.
